ChemInform Abstract: Dilute Magnetic Semiconductor Cu2MnSnS4 Nanocrystals with a Novel Zincblende and Wurtzite Structure.

Abstract

Abstract For the first time, Cu 2 MnSnS 4 nanocrystals with wurtzite and zincblende structure are synthesized by injecting an oleylamine solution of sulfur powder and thiourea, resp., into an oleylamine solution of Cu(OAc) 2 , SnCl 4 , and Mn(OAc) 2 at 270 °C.
